我正在尝试动态创建多个流。例如。
li
{'event_type': 'temperature',
'users' : ['john', 'gary'],
'data': {'type': 'temperature',
'DeviceID': 'bcd', 'temperature': '45',
'timestamp': '2019-03-22T12:32:02.208223Z'
}
}
的可能值为type
。
所需的输出是每个用户一个流,每个用户类型组合一个流
['temperature','geolocation,'pressure']
我尝试了https://docs.wso2.com/display/SP4xx/Complex+JSON+Processing 用于复杂的json处理,但是@source语法没有明确提及。
答案 0 :(得分:0)
没有,这在Siddhi中是不可能的。在Siddhi中,流是预定义的,无法基于事件属性创建。